Casa Aravell Winery in Ordino stands as a pioneer of high-altitude viticulture in the Pyrenees, marking a successful revival of a winemaking tradition that had nearly vanished from Andorra for centuries. This small, family-run estate focuses on producing premium wines that reflect the rugged beauty of the mountains. The vineyards are situated on steep terraces around Ordino, where grapes like Riesling and Pinot Noir thrive in the cool, crisp air and intense sunlight of the Pyrenean peaks. Due to the challenging terrain, almost all the work, from pruning to harvesting, is done by hand, a practice often referred to as 'heroic viticulture'. The production is strictly limited, with only a few thousand bottles produced each year, ensuring that each vintage is a unique expression of the local soil. What is this place?
The Casa Aravell Winery in Ordino is a small family-run business that passionately maintains the Pyrenean wine tradition. It produces quality wines from local grape varieties, representing the region's cultural winemaking heritage.
🚪
Visiting
As a small family business, the winery is usually open for visits and tastings by prior telephone appointment. The vineyards and the traditional building are clearly visible from the road.

🧺
Local products
The winery mainly produces red and white wines from grape varieties adapted to the high-altitude climate. The wines are available at the winery, in local shops in Ordino, and in restaurants in Andorra la Vella.
📆
Active season
The main activity is during the harvest period from September to October. Also in spring, during the budding of the vines, the operation is very lively when the vineyards are in full bloom.
